You might want to check your GW .dat file as it might have become corrupt.

You can check this by adding the "-repair" switch to the target in the GW shortcut icon.

Also, as Demonlord Matt stated, you might want to check for new drivers etc too.

Graphics card drivers, try a roll back and then a reinstall of the latest to see if it helps. If not, delete (OR MOVE) your gw.dat from the GW folder and do the -image command from the shortcut or windows runline command to build yourself a new dat without corruption (last resort). If you go -image, do it overnight while you sleep. -Repair might take a while too.
